The South Australian Research and Development Institute (SARDI) is the research arm of the Department of Primary Industries and Regions (PIRSA). SARDI conducts independent applied research to help South Australia's primary industries, regions, and communities grow and prosper. Working with industry, government, and research organisations, SARDI delivers practical, evidence-based solutions to improve productivity, manage climate and biosecurity risk, support sustainable resource use, strengthen market access, and drive food and agri-food innovation across key sectors for long-term impact.
We are a passionate team of around 800 people working across metropolitan and regional South Australia to develop and protect our state's regions and food, wine, aquaculture, fisheries, forestry, grains, livestock, dairy and horticulture industries.
